How to Buy Quantfury

Quantfury (QTF) is a cryptocurrency you can acquire through several channels in the digital asset marketplace. This guide outlines the key ways to buy and store QTF, detailing the benefits and considerations of each method so you can understand how to purchase on Quantfury.

Centralized Exchanges

Centralized exchanges (CEX) are the most beginner-friendly option for acquiring Quantfury. These platforms act as intermediaries between buyers and sellers, delivering intuitive interfaces and streamlined processes for purchasing cryptocurrencies.

When selecting a centralized exchange, evaluate several critical factors. Security comes first—look for features like two-factor authentication and cold asset storage. Platform liquidity lets you buy or sell quickly with minimal price impact. Competitive fee structures are also important, including transaction, deposit, and withdrawal fees.

The typical buying process on a centralized exchange involves creating a secure account, completing identity verification (KYC), adding a payment method (credit card, wire transfer), and then purchasing directly with fiat or swapping another cryptocurrency like USDT for Quantfury.

Crypto Wallets

Crypto wallets provide an appealing alternative for buying Quantfury, combining purchase access and secure asset storage. Non-custodial wallets allow you to maintain full control of your digital assets.

These solutions offer notable advantages. First, they deliver enhanced security since you hold your own private keys. Second, they let you interact with the decentralized ecosystem (DApps, NFTs, DeFi). Third, they typically support thousands of cryptocurrencies.

To buy Quantfury with a wallet, download the app, create or import your wallet while safeguarding your recovery phrase (seed phrase), then purchase directly if supported, or first acquire a popular cryptocurrency and swap it for QTF. Keep in mind that fees may be higher than on traditional exchanges.

Decentralized Exchanges

Decentralized exchanges (DEX) operate without intermediaries by leveraging smart contracts. These automated protocols enable direct peer-to-peer trading, providing increased privacy and control for those who want to buy Quantfury independently.

DEX platforms stand out for several reasons: no registration or identity checks, full custody of your assets, and access to thousands of trading pairs. However, they require greater technical expertise and incur blockchain transaction (gas) fees.

Buying on a DEX involves several steps. First, choose a platform compatible with the Quantfury blockchain, then connect a Web3 wallet. Next, obtain the network's base currency (like ETH for Ethereum) from a centralized exchange, transfer it to your wallet, and trade it for Quantfury. You'll need native tokens to pay network fees, and it’s important to set the correct slippage tolerance.

Store Your Quantfury on an Exchange

Storing Quantfury on a centralized exchange provides maximum convenience for active traders. This method offers instant access to investment features such as spot trading, futures contracts, staking, and lending.

Benefits include ease of use, rapid market access, and opportunities to earn passive income through various financial products. The exchange handles fund security, removing the risk of losing your private keys.

However, this approach means entrusting your assets to a third party. Always choose a reputable exchange with robust security—look for deposit insurance, cold storage, and regular security audits. Enable all available account protections, including two-factor authentication and withdrawal address whitelisting.

HODL Quantfury in Non-Custodial Wallets

The “Not your keys, not your coins” philosophy is a core principle in the crypto space. If you want maximum security and full control after learning how to buy Quantfury, non-custodial wallets are your best option.

These wallets come in several forms: hardware wallets for maximum security, Web3 wallets for decentralized app interaction, and paper wallets for cold storage. Each type offers distinct advantages based on your needs.

Managing your Quantfury independently means total responsibility. Back up your recovery phrase in multiple secure physical locations. Losing this phrase means permanent loss of your assets, with no recovery possible. This approach suits long-term investors (HODLers) who don’t need frequent access for trading.

You can also combine strategies: keep some Quantfury on an exchange for active trading and yield generation, while securing a larger amount in a non-custodial wallet for long-term storage.
